Here in Ibaraki at the international affairs division we are in the midst of planning an "International Sports Day" which we have nicknamed "Be a Sport"
The plan is to use sport to break down communication barriers between the Japanese people and foriegners living in Ibaraki through the use of an "universal language" of sport. This year is the UN's International year of Sport and Physical Education we were able to get a bit of a budget
to run such an event.
We have chosen sports that most Japanese people will have never had access to before and we are going to use other JETs from our prefecture as instructors.
Some of the sports we will use include
- Cricket
- American Football
- Ultimate Frisbee
- Petanque
- Double dutch
- Dodge ball
- Kickball
- Baggo
